Output 21ce7a28febba6c2557e101b3d3d7012a62498f723f751510f3ae138dd049193:0

value
33951903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ee95e25b8115351c1fed477b8d1c61220aa6b0a1 OP_EQUAL
address
3PSYJLVDHkbDUaSvq5v7YamyuFSK2FhQqJ
transaction
21ce7a28febba6c2557e101b3d3d7012a62498f723f751510f3ae138dd049193
confirmations
217584
spent
true